I use RKL and love it!!! I got it because of the price initially, but now I absolutely love it. The two biggest things that I like about rkl are the fact that you can add on modules as you need them and/or have the money. and also if/when you want step up to RKE all the modules will go with it and Digital Aquatics will give $50 to trade in the RKL head unit.

Neither is really capable of much more than the other (in the full feature versions) however out of the box I'd prefer apex for it's user interface and built in net capability. I also use an RKl on my Qt system, and it's hard to beat it bang for the buck. It controls lights, skimmer, pump and temp out of the box. Add sl1 and you can do ATO and have backup temp probe and PH for ~$200. Good deal for a flexible setup. I just like the apex much more. back to the basic question, what is it that you hope a controller can do for you?

if for just lightning and temperature. any controller would do the job fine. just go with what works best for your budget.
Unless you have a huge sophisticated setup. I think a $550 controller just for your setup is way toooooooooooo much.
If you have never own one, I would suggest go for the basic one. You can always upgrade or sell + buy a more expensive one later.
I am using just the basic Reef Keeper Lite on my 120g just to control the lightning and the temperature. I am happy just like this :)
I am not sure the purpose for using the controller to control pump, power heads...etc.

Talking about the osmolator. The osmolator auto top off itself is a controller. You do not need a separate controller like the reef keeper or the neptune.....

major of the people use the controller to control the temperature and control the lightning, top off and some use to control the ph.

I use my GHL Profilux controller to
-Control lights.
-Temperature with heater and fan.
-Skimmer turns off when return pump is turned off or when water in the sump hit the maximum allowed line
-ATO
-Dosing Alk, Ca, MG. Alarm with conductivity is too high in an event of overdosing.
-Alarm when display tank water level is above maximum allowed in an event of a clogged drain.
-Email me if anything that cause the alarm(Temps, Conductivity, PH, Level sensor).
-Turn off certain things when I'm working on the tank. Ie. waterchange or skimmer cleaning.
-Remote access. C'mon, who wouldn't want to know what's the tank is doing when they're in the other side of the globe.
